Today’s article discusses how retirement stereotypes are being changed by the new crop of would-be retirees. Here’s what they had to say, ” According to the Employee Benefits Research Institute, in 1991, just 11% of workers expected to retire after age 65. That jumped to 33% last year. Another 10%, like Fraser and Levinson, don’t plan to retire at all. Meanwhile, the percentage of workers who expect to be able to retire before age 65 has dropped dramatically, from 50% in 1991 to just 27% last year.” To read more, CLICK HERE.
